Christian Web News - So, it's illegal to buy beer in Cullman County, but yet a preacher is talking about the delicate subject of S-E-X on Sunday morning?
Daystar Church pastor Jerry Lawson's monthlong focus on sex has run up against some opposition in Good Hope -- a conservative north Alabama community. Some people are upset over the church's billboards, which advertise the sermon series and accompanying Web site.
Lawson says the purpose of his sermons and the signs is to get Christian parents talking to their kids about sex before they learn too much immorality from TV or playground buddies.
When Lawson arrived nearly nine years ago, Daystar was a country church. In 2002, the church "relaunched" itself in the pattern of an urban megachurch.
